The soft range of the energy spectrum of 79Au198 was measured by means of a magnetic lens β-ray spectrometer. The part of the spectrogram so obtained shows a part of continuous β-spectrum and a broad line spectrum of secondary β-rays ejected from the L-level of gold by the softest component of non-corpuscular radiation first found by Richardson. The peak of the line spectrum at Hρ=837.5 corresponds to the maximum energy of 58.4 kev of electrons ejected from L-group of gold. The energy of the radiation which might have given rise to these β-rays must be 70.3 kev with a wave-length λ=175.7 x.u. This value of λ is practically identical with the estimated value of the wave-length of Kα1 line of mercury. The breadth and the spread of the line towards the low energy side indicate that the spectrum of the L-group of electrons of gold, ejected by a 70.3-kev energy radiation partly overlaps another line spectrum of the same group of electrons ejected by a radiation, softer than 70.3 kev radiation by an energy of the order of only a few kev. This softer one could be identical with the K-radiation of 78Pt198. The softest component of non-corpuscular radiation found in 79Au198 is therefore very likely composed of the K-radiation of 78Pt198, and the K-radiation of 80Hg198. From the evidence, the radioactive isotope of gold 79Au198 appears to have a dual transition, a transition to 80Hg198 following β-decay and another to 78Pt198, following K-capture as assumed by Sizoo and Eijkman.
